Harmony Circle Logo
The logo reflects the aim of the Racial and Religious Harmony Circle to serve as a bridge between religious, ethnic and community groups. It is made up of similar curved slices converging to form a united circle.

The negative space between their forms suggests continuous movement and dynamism. The coloured slices represent the 4 values of Harmony Circles - trust, respect, harmony and co-operation and the constant momentum to embrace these values in our multiracial and multi-religious society to maintain racial and religious harmony in Singapore.
